Methi Population - Nanded, Maharashtra

Methi is a medium size village located in Mukhed Taluka of Nanded district, Maharashtra with total 237 families residing. The Methi village has population of 990 of which 504 are males while 486 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Methi village population of children with age 0-6 is 152 which makes up 15.35 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Methi village is 964 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Methi as per census is 1082,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Methi village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Methi village was 80.19 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Methi Male literacy stands at 84.45 % while female literacy rate was 75.68 %.

Caste Factor

In Methi village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C) &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 32.22 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 25.05 % of total population in Methi village.

Work Profile

In Methi village out of total population, 543 were engaged in work activities. 94.66 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.34 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 543 workers engaged in Main Work, 126 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 356 were Agricultural labourer.
